When we look at how ordinary people have used the term human and its equivalents across cultures and throughout the span of history, we discover that often (maybe even typically) members of our species are explicitly excluded from the category of the human. This goes a long way towards explaining why a statement of the form x is human, in the mouth of a biologist might mean x is a member of the species Homo sapiens while the very same statement in the mouth of a Nazi might mean x is a member of the Aryan race.
